How much do aviation strategic management j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for aviation strategic management in the United States is $107,148.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$77,000.00 and $131,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Primary Function

Ardurra is looking for an Aviation Project Manager for our growing Aviation Group. In this key role, you will be responsible for overseeing projects and serving as a client manager for airport design and construction projects within specific regions. The ideal individual will provide mentoring to junior staff, lead QA/QC efforts, and play a strategic role in expanding Ardurra's aviation presence through client relationship management and business development initiatives. The ideal individual for this role will be joining a well-established aviation group with a diverse workload of airfield and airport improvement projects. From project planning, regulatory approvals, environmental compliance, financial planning, legislative strategy, land acquisition, and design phasing, this individual will be heavily involved in projects from concept through completion.

In addition to project delivery, this role will be instrumental in identifying new business opportunities, developing and maintaining relationships with airport sponsors, aviation agencies, industry partners, and supporting proposal and pursuit efforts. The Aviation Project Manager will collaborate with leadership to drive growth within targeted markets, participate in industry organizations and conferences, and help position Ardurra for upcoming aviation planning, design, and construction opportunities. Success in this role requires both strong technical expertise and a proactive approach to client development, market expansion, and strategic growth initiatives. 

Primary Duties

  • Project management
  • Marketing
  • Client development
  • Staff Supervision and mentoring
  • Quality control of project design and contract documents
  • Office Support during construction 

Education and Experience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ering or a related field
  • PE License
  • 8+ years' experience in the airport design and/or construction field, either in private industry or government service
  • Airport design, construction administration, and project management experience
  • Strong knowledge of FAA advisory circulars related to airport design and the FAA grant process
  • Strong computer skills
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Ability to lead and mentor existing staff and develop new staff as needed to support growth of the aviation group
  • Self-motivated, team-oriented individual with the ability to work on challenging projects in a team environment
